exhaust DIY
Looking for a diy exhaust removal and install for the headers back to the rear section. Seems like it should be fairly straightforward just curious if there are any special things you need to do to get good seal at the o2 sensor and other connections.

The easiest way is to back the car onto ramps, put the rear section on and then put it down, the pull forward onto ramps to do the x pipe. It's a real pain to do on stands or ramps, though, they just aren't high enough to easily move stuff around.
